When shipping from Tanjung Pelepas, Malaysia to Vancouver, Canada, prepare for significant delays due to the Southeast Asia monsoon season (May-September) and the Indian Ocean cyclone season (April-June and October-December). Build in buffer days to your schedules and maintain communication with carriers for real-time updates. During peak holiday periods, such as Christmas (October-December) and Lunar New Year (January-February), book vessel space well in advance to avoid congestion and ensure timely deliveries. Stay aware of weather conditions and adjust routes as necessary to mitigate disruptions.

Transporting temperature-sensitive Pharma products demands qualified cold-chain containers, Appropriate refrigerants, and unbroken temperature monitoring. Use an express service where possible, pre-cool gel packs, and place a data logger in the carton to verify that medical drugs stayed within their labeled temperature range.
Fragile glass vials of pharmaceutical goods Should be packed in compartmental inserts with surrounding foam. Place trays inside a double-walled box and Fill void-fill so nothing moves. For moisture-sensitive medical drugs, pair this with moisture-barrier inner bags and desiccants.
International shipments of medical drugs typically Require a detailed commercial invoice, packing list, and any permits required by the importing country. Several markets also Expect Certificates of Analysis, proof of GDP-compliant handling, and clear temperature instructions for cold-chain medicines. Double-check requirements with your customs broker before shipping.
For moisture-sensitive pharmaceutical goods, Use high-barrier bags plus desiccant sachets inside the packaging. Close cartons tightly, avoid damaged boxes, and Choose transport options that reduce exposure to rain and high humidity, such as covered docks and climate-controlled linehaul for medical drugs.
High-value medical drugs Benefit from enhanced cargo insurance that covers temperature excursions, breakage, and theft. Coordinate with an insurer familiar with pharmaceutical goods, Declare the full replacement value, and retain temperature and handling records so claims can be processed efficiently if something goes wrong.
